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(89)

Side by Side Diff: ui/gl/gl_bindings_autogen_gl.h

Issue 1822643002: [Command buffer] Enable primitive restart for WebGL 2 (Closed) Base URL: https://chromium.googlesource.com/chromium/src.git@master
Patch Set: fix coding style and update webgl2_conformance_expectations.py Created 4 years, 8 months 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View unified diff | Download patch
« no previous file with comments | « ui/gl/gl_bindings_api_autogen_gl.h ('k') | ui/gl/gl_bindings_autogen_gl.cc » ('j') | no next file with comments »
Toggle Intra-line Diffs ('i') | Expand Comments ('e') | Collapse Comments ('c') | Show Comments Hide Comments ('s')
OLDNEW
1 // Copyright 2014 The Chromium Authors. All rights reserved. 1 // Copyright 2014 The Chromium Authors. All rights reserved.
2 // Use of this source code is governed by a BSD-style license that can be 2 // Use of this source code is governed by a BSD-style license that can be
3 // found in the LICENSE file. 3 // found in the LICENSE file.
4 // 4 //
5 // This file is auto-generated from 5 // This file is auto-generated from
6 // ui/gl/generate_bindings.py 6 // ui/gl/generate_bindings.py
7 // It's formatted by clang-format using chromium coding style: 7 // It's formatted by clang-format using chromium coding style:
8 // clang-format -i -style=chromium filename 8 // clang-format -i -style=chromium filename
9 // DO NOT EDIT! 9 // DO NOT EDIT!
10 10
(...skipping 619 matching lines...) Expand 10 before | Expand all | Expand 10 after
630 GLint value); 630 GLint value);
631 typedef void(GL_BINDING_CALL* glPathStencilFuncNVProc)(GLenum func, 631 typedef void(GL_BINDING_CALL* glPathStencilFuncNVProc)(GLenum func,
632 GLint ref, 632 GLint ref,
633 GLuint mask); 633 GLuint mask);
634 typedef void(GL_BINDING_CALL* glPauseTransformFeedbackProc)(void); 634 typedef void(GL_BINDING_CALL* glPauseTransformFeedbackProc)(void);
635 typedef void(GL_BINDING_CALL* glPixelStoreiProc)(GLenum pname, GLint param); 635 typedef void(GL_BINDING_CALL* glPixelStoreiProc)(GLenum pname, GLint param);
636 typedef void(GL_BINDING_CALL* glPointParameteriProc)(GLenum pname, GLint param); 636 typedef void(GL_BINDING_CALL* glPointParameteriProc)(GLenum pname, GLint param);
637 typedef void(GL_BINDING_CALL* glPolygonOffsetProc)(GLfloat factor, 637 typedef void(GL_BINDING_CALL* glPolygonOffsetProc)(GLfloat factor,
638 GLfloat units); 638 GLfloat units);
639 typedef void(GL_BINDING_CALL* glPopGroupMarkerEXTProc)(void); 639 typedef void(GL_BINDING_CALL* glPopGroupMarkerEXTProc)(void);
640 typedef void(GL_BINDING_CALL* glPrimitiveRestartIndexProc)(GLuint index);
640 typedef void(GL_BINDING_CALL* glProgramBinaryProc)(GLuint program, 641 typedef void(GL_BINDING_CALL* glProgramBinaryProc)(GLuint program,
641 GLenum binaryFormat, 642 GLenum binaryFormat,
642 const GLvoid* binary, 643 const GLvoid* binary,
643 GLsizei length); 644 GLsizei length);
644 typedef void(GL_BINDING_CALL* glProgramParameteriProc)(GLuint program, 645 typedef void(GL_BINDING_CALL* glProgramParameteriProc)(GLuint program,
645 GLenum pname, 646 GLenum pname,
646 GLint value); 647 GLint value);
647 typedef void(GL_BINDING_CALL* glProgramPathFragmentInputGenNVProc)( 648 typedef void(GL_BINDING_CALL* glProgramPathFragmentInputGenNVProc)(
648 GLuint program, 649 GLuint program,
649 GLint location, 650 GLint location,
(...skipping 649 matching lines...) Expand 10 before | Expand all | Expand 10 after
1299 glMemoryBarrierEXTProc glMemoryBarrierEXTFn; 1300 glMemoryBarrierEXTProc glMemoryBarrierEXTFn;
1300 glPathCommandsNVProc glPathCommandsNVFn; 1301 glPathCommandsNVProc glPathCommandsNVFn;
1301 glPathParameterfNVProc glPathParameterfNVFn; 1302 glPathParameterfNVProc glPathParameterfNVFn;
1302 glPathParameteriNVProc glPathParameteriNVFn; 1303 glPathParameteriNVProc glPathParameteriNVFn;
1303 glPathStencilFuncNVProc glPathStencilFuncNVFn; 1304 glPathStencilFuncNVProc glPathStencilFuncNVFn;
1304 glPauseTransformFeedbackProc glPauseTransformFeedbackFn; 1305 glPauseTransformFeedbackProc glPauseTransformFeedbackFn;
1305 glPixelStoreiProc glPixelStoreiFn; 1306 glPixelStoreiProc glPixelStoreiFn;
1306 glPointParameteriProc glPointParameteriFn; 1307 glPointParameteriProc glPointParameteriFn;
1307 glPolygonOffsetProc glPolygonOffsetFn; 1308 glPolygonOffsetProc glPolygonOffsetFn;
1308 glPopGroupMarkerEXTProc glPopGroupMarkerEXTFn; 1309 glPopGroupMarkerEXTProc glPopGroupMarkerEXTFn;
1310 glPrimitiveRestartIndexProc glPrimitiveRestartIndexFn;
1309 glProgramBinaryProc glProgramBinaryFn; 1311 glProgramBinaryProc glProgramBinaryFn;
1310 glProgramParameteriProc glProgramParameteriFn; 1312 glProgramParameteriProc glProgramParameteriFn;
1311 glProgramPathFragmentInputGenNVProc glProgramPathFragmentInputGenNVFn; 1313 glProgramPathFragmentInputGenNVProc glProgramPathFragmentInputGenNVFn;
1312 glPushGroupMarkerEXTProc glPushGroupMarkerEXTFn; 1314 glPushGroupMarkerEXTProc glPushGroupMarkerEXTFn;
1313 glQueryCounterProc glQueryCounterFn; 1315 glQueryCounterProc glQueryCounterFn;
1314 glReadBufferProc glReadBufferFn; 1316 glReadBufferProc glReadBufferFn;
1315 glReadPixelsProc glReadPixelsFn; 1317 glReadPixelsProc glReadPixelsFn;
1316 glReleaseShaderCompilerProc glReleaseShaderCompilerFn; 1318 glReleaseShaderCompilerProc glReleaseShaderCompilerFn;
1317 glRenderbufferStorageEXTProc glRenderbufferStorageEXTFn; 1319 glRenderbufferStorageEXTProc glRenderbufferStorageEXTFn;
1318 glRenderbufferStorageMultisampleProc glRenderbufferStorageMultisampleFn; 1320 glRenderbufferStorageMultisampleProc glRenderbufferStorageMultisampleFn;
(...skipping 638 matching lines...) Expand 10 before | Expand all | Expand 10 after
1957 virtual void glPathParameterfNVFn(GLuint path, 1959 virtual void glPathParameterfNVFn(GLuint path,
1958 GLenum pname, 1960 GLenum pname,
1959 GLfloat value) = 0; 1961 GLfloat value) = 0;
1960 virtual void glPathParameteriNVFn(GLuint path, GLenum pname, GLint value) = 0; 1962 virtual void glPathParameteriNVFn(GLuint path, GLenum pname, GLint value) = 0;
1961 virtual void glPathStencilFuncNVFn(GLenum func, GLint ref, GLuint mask) = 0; 1963 virtual void glPathStencilFuncNVFn(GLenum func, GLint ref, GLuint mask) = 0;
1962 virtual void glPauseTransformFeedbackFn(void) = 0; 1964 virtual void glPauseTransformFeedbackFn(void) = 0;
1963 virtual void glPixelStoreiFn(GLenum pname, GLint param) = 0; 1965 virtual void glPixelStoreiFn(GLenum pname, GLint param) = 0;
1964 virtual void glPointParameteriFn(GLenum pname, GLint param) = 0; 1966 virtual void glPointParameteriFn(GLenum pname, GLint param) = 0;
1965 virtual void glPolygonOffsetFn(GLfloat factor, GLfloat units) = 0; 1967 virtual void glPolygonOffsetFn(GLfloat factor, GLfloat units) = 0;
1966 virtual void glPopGroupMarkerEXTFn(void) = 0; 1968 virtual void glPopGroupMarkerEXTFn(void) = 0;
1969 virtual void glPrimitiveRestartIndexFn(GLuint index) = 0;
1967 virtual void glProgramBinaryFn(GLuint program, 1970 virtual void glProgramBinaryFn(GLuint program,
1968 GLenum binaryFormat, 1971 GLenum binaryFormat,
1969 const GLvoid* binary, 1972 const GLvoid* binary,
1970 GLsizei length) = 0; 1973 GLsizei length) = 0;
1971 virtual void glProgramParameteriFn(GLuint program, 1974 virtual void glProgramParameteriFn(GLuint program,
1972 GLenum pname, 1975 GLenum pname,
1973 GLint value) = 0; 1976 GLint value) = 0;
1974 virtual void glProgramPathFragmentInputGenNVFn(GLuint program, 1977 virtual void glProgramPathFragmentInputGenNVFn(GLuint program,
1975 GLint location, 1978 GLint location,
1976 GLenum genMode, 1979 GLenum genMode,
(...skipping 617 matching lines...) Expand 10 before | Expand all | Expand 10 after
2594 #define glPathCommandsNV ::gfx::g_current_gl_context->glPathCommandsNVFn 2597 #define glPathCommandsNV ::gfx::g_current_gl_context->glPathCommandsNVFn
2595 #define glPathParameterfNV ::gfx::g_current_gl_context->glPathParameterfNVFn 2598 #define glPathParameterfNV ::gfx::g_current_gl_context->glPathParameterfNVFn
2596 #define glPathParameteriNV ::gfx::g_current_gl_context->glPathParameteriNVFn 2599 #define glPathParameteriNV ::gfx::g_current_gl_context->glPathParameteriNVFn
2597 #define glPathStencilFuncNV ::gfx::g_current_gl_context->glPathStencilFuncNVFn 2600 #define glPathStencilFuncNV ::gfx::g_current_gl_context->glPathStencilFuncNVFn
2598 #define glPauseTransformFeedback \ 2601 #define glPauseTransformFeedback \
2599 ::gfx::g_current_gl_context->glPauseTransformFeedbackFn 2602 ::gfx::g_current_gl_context->glPauseTransformFeedbackFn
2600 #define glPixelStorei ::gfx::g_current_gl_context->glPixelStoreiFn 2603 #define glPixelStorei ::gfx::g_current_gl_context->glPixelStoreiFn
2601 #define glPointParameteri ::gfx::g_current_gl_context->glPointParameteriFn 2604 #define glPointParameteri ::gfx::g_current_gl_context->glPointParameteriFn
2602 #define glPolygonOffset ::gfx::g_current_gl_context->glPolygonOffsetFn 2605 #define glPolygonOffset ::gfx::g_current_gl_context->glPolygonOffsetFn
2603 #define glPopGroupMarkerEXT ::gfx::g_current_gl_context->glPopGroupMarkerEXTFn 2606 #define glPopGroupMarkerEXT ::gfx::g_current_gl_context->glPopGroupMarkerEXTFn
2607 #define glPrimitiveRestartIndex \
2608 ::gfx::g_current_gl_context->glPrimitiveRestartIndexFn
2604 #define glProgramBinary ::gfx::g_current_gl_context->glProgramBinaryFn 2609 #define glProgramBinary ::gfx::g_current_gl_context->glProgramBinaryFn
2605 #define glProgramParameteri ::gfx::g_current_gl_context->glProgramParameteriFn 2610 #define glProgramParameteri ::gfx::g_current_gl_context->glProgramParameteriFn
2606 #define glProgramPathFragmentInputGenNV \ 2611 #define glProgramPathFragmentInputGenNV \
2607 ::gfx::g_current_gl_context->glProgramPathFragmentInputGenNVFn 2612 ::gfx::g_current_gl_context->glProgramPathFragmentInputGenNVFn
2608 #define glPushGroupMarkerEXT ::gfx::g_current_gl_context->glPushGroupMarkerEXTFn 2613 #define glPushGroupMarkerEXT ::gfx::g_current_gl_context->glPushGroupMarkerEXTFn
2609 #define glQueryCounter ::gfx::g_current_gl_context->glQueryCounterFn 2614 #define glQueryCounter ::gfx::g_current_gl_context->glQueryCounterFn
2610 #define glReadBuffer ::gfx::g_current_gl_context->glReadBufferFn 2615 #define glReadBuffer ::gfx::g_current_gl_context->glReadBufferFn
2611 #define glReadPixels ::gfx::g_current_gl_context->glReadPixelsFn 2616 #define glReadPixels ::gfx::g_current_gl_context->glReadPixelsFn
2612 #define glReleaseShaderCompiler \ 2617 #define glReleaseShaderCompiler \
2613 ::gfx::g_current_gl_context->glReleaseShaderCompilerFn 2618 ::gfx::g_current_gl_context->glReleaseShaderCompilerFn
(...skipping 109 matching lines...) Expand 10 before | Expand all | Expand 10 after
2723 #define glVertexAttribI4ui ::gfx::g_current_gl_context->glVertexAttribI4uiFn 2728 #define glVertexAttribI4ui ::gfx::g_current_gl_context->glVertexAttribI4uiFn
2724 #define glVertexAttribI4uiv ::gfx::g_current_gl_context->glVertexAttribI4uivFn 2729 #define glVertexAttribI4uiv ::gfx::g_current_gl_context->glVertexAttribI4uivFn
2725 #define glVertexAttribIPointer \ 2730 #define glVertexAttribIPointer \
2726 ::gfx::g_current_gl_context->glVertexAttribIPointerFn 2731 ::gfx::g_current_gl_context->glVertexAttribIPointerFn
2727 #define glVertexAttribPointer \ 2732 #define glVertexAttribPointer \
2728 ::gfx::g_current_gl_context->glVertexAttribPointerFn 2733 ::gfx::g_current_gl_context->glVertexAttribPointerFn
2729 #define glViewport ::gfx::g_current_gl_context->glViewportFn 2734 #define glViewport ::gfx::g_current_gl_context->glViewportFn
2730 #define glWaitSync ::gfx::g_current_gl_context->glWaitSyncFn 2735 #define glWaitSync ::gfx::g_current_gl_context->glWaitSyncFn
2731 2736
2732 #endif // UI_GFX_GL_GL_BINDINGS_AUTOGEN_GL_H_ 2737 #endif // UI_GFX_GL_GL_BINDINGS_AUTOGEN_GL_H_
OLDNEW
« no previous file with comments | « ui/gl/gl_bindings_api_autogen_gl.h ('k') | ui/gl/gl_bindings_autogen_gl.cc » ('j') | no next file with comments »

Powered by Google App Engine
This is Rietveld 408576698